PEEAM Announces ‘The Shining Edupreneurs’s Awards

An appreciation to education institutions during this challenging time

0
The Private Education Entrepreneur Association of Malaysia (PEEAM) will be hosting the 2nd PEEAM Private Education Awards later this year

With pandemic constraints looming since last year and to date, it has proven to be a difficult year for many corporate sectors. The education sector is no exception, particularly the private sector.

This year, the Malaysian Private Education Entrepreneur Association (PEEAM) will conduct the 2nd PEEAM Private Education Awards to honour exceptional education entrepreneurs. PEEAM will add Education Business Sustainability, Outstanding Education Centre, Outstanding Education Franchisor, Outstanding Education Licensor, Inspiring Learning Spaces, Outstanding Education Product & Services, and Outstanding Virtual Learning to its award categories this year.

“We aim to provide continued support to the private education sector and to recognise and honour exceptional entrepreneurs, individuals and organisations that have shown great contributions in leading the education industry throughout the pandemic. The goal is for the awards to become the most credible Private Education Awards in Malaysia,” said Datin Nonadiah Abdullah, Chairman of PEEAM.

The Awards also hope to encourage others by highlighting role models of greatness. The purpose is to recognise industry professionals for their outstanding contributions to the education sector while also raising public awareness of new, developing and leading educational institutions.

PEEAM EduAwards theme – ‘The Shining Edupreneurs’, hosted by PEEAM and organised by Uniquecom, will be a virtual award ceremony on 4th December 2021 from 6 pm to 10 pm, offering free nominations for private edupreneurs and free admission for visitors.

“The awards consist of seven (7) categories and are targeted to all K12 private education institutions ranging from Childcare centres (TASKA), Kindergartens (Tadika), Daycares (Pusat Jagaan), Tuition centres, Enrichment Centres, Private Schools and Educational Products and Services. The closing date for nomination is on 30th September 2021 (Thursday), 23.59pm,” said Jeff Tan Chin Horng, the Organising Committee Chairman of PEEAM EduAwards 2021.
